Form 4: Atlassian Co-Founder Sells Shares Under 10b5-1 Plan

Sentiment:

Insider Transaction Report


Atlassian CEO and Co-Founder Michael Cannon-Brookes sold 7,665 shares of Class A Common Stock on October 24, 2025, under a pre-arranged 10b5-1 trading plan.

Summary

  • Michael Cannon-Brookes, CEO, Co-Founder, Director, and 10% Owner of Atlassian Corp (TEAM), reported sales of Class A Common Stock.
  • A total of 7,665 shares were sold across multiple transactions on October 24, 2025.
  • The sales were executed at weighted-average prices ranging from $162.5042 to $167.5 per share.
  • These transactions were conducted pursuant to a Rule 10b5-1 trading plan adopted by Mr. Cannon-Brookes on February 20, 2025.
  • Following these transactions, Mr. Cannon-Brookes indirectly beneficially owns 352,590 shares of Class A Common Stock through CBC Co Pty Limited as trustee for the Cannon-Brookes Head Trust.
